mirror of
https://github.com/meteor/meteor.git
synced 2026-05-02 03:01:46 -04:00
- fix test: unknown release"
This commit is contained in:
@@ -1037,7 +1037,7 @@ makeGlobalAsyncLocalStorage().run({}, async function () {
|
||||
// ATTEMPT 2: legacy release, on disk. (And it's a "real" release, not a
|
||||
// "red pill" release which has the same name as a modern release!)
|
||||
if (warehouse.realReleaseExistsInWarehouse(releaseName)) {
|
||||
var manifest = warehouse.ensureReleaseExistsAndReturnManifest(
|
||||
var manifest = await warehouse.ensureReleaseExistsAndReturnManifest(
|
||||
releaseName);
|
||||
await oldSpringboard(manifest.tools); // doesn't return
|
||||
}
|
||||
@@ -1062,7 +1062,7 @@ makeGlobalAsyncLocalStorage().run({}, async function () {
|
||||
// ATTEMPT 4: legacy release, loading from warehouse server.
|
||||
manifest = null;
|
||||
try {
|
||||
manifest = warehouse.ensureReleaseExistsAndReturnManifest(
|
||||
manifest = await warehouse.ensureReleaseExistsAndReturnManifest(
|
||||
releaseName);
|
||||
} catch (e) {
|
||||
// Note: this is WAREHOUSE's NoSuchReleaseError, not RELEASE's
|
||||
|
||||
@@ -191,7 +191,7 @@ Object.assign(warehouse, {
|
||||
// fetches the manifest file for the given release version. also fetches
|
||||
// all of the missing versioned packages referenced from the release manifest
|
||||
// @param releaseVersion {String} eg "0.1"
|
||||
_populateWarehouseForRelease: function (releaseVersion, showInstalling) {
|
||||
_populateWarehouseForRelease: async function (releaseVersion, showInstalling) {
|
||||
var releasesDir = files.pathJoin(warehouse.getWarehouseDir(), 'releases');
|
||||
files.mkdir_p(releasesDir, 0o755);
|
||||
var releaseManifestPath = files.pathJoin(releasesDir,
|
||||
@@ -221,7 +221,7 @@ Object.assign(warehouse, {
|
||||
}
|
||||
|
||||
try {
|
||||
var result = httpHelpers.request(
|
||||
var result = await httpHelpers.request(
|
||||
WAREHOUSE_URLBASE + "/releases/" + releaseVersion + ".release.json");
|
||||
} catch (e) {
|
||||
throw new files.OfflineError(e);
|
||||
|
||||
Reference in New Issue
Block a user